⏱ 1-Minute Summary Beyond the classic short iron condor, this family adds iron butterflies, the long (debit) iron condor, the broken-wing condor, and the jade lizard. The credit versions harvest theta when IV is high and the stock is range-bound; the long iron condor bets on a breakout. Modified wings change where the loss lands.
1. Beyond the Standard Iron Condor
The previous article covered the short iron condor (sell OTM put + sell OTM call, protect with wings). This article covers the rest of the family the simulator supports:
- Iron butterfly: sell ATM put + sell ATM call (long and short versions).
- Long iron condor: buy an inner OTM spread and sell an outer OTM spread on both sides (debit).
- Broken-wing condor: short condor with one wider wing.
- Jade lizard: short put + short call + long higher call.


The chart above shows vega from the short option's perspective, how much an option's price changes per 1% move in implied volatility, as the IV level itself changes. It assumes a stock price of $200, 45 days to expiry, and lines for strikes of $180, $200 and $220. Because the panels show short options, every value is negative: the at-the-money line (blue) is nearly flat at about -0.24 across the whole IV range, because an at-the-money option's vega barely depends on the IV level. The out-of-the-money line (green, strike $220) falls with IV: about -0.11 at 25% IV and -0.20 at 50% IV, and the in-the-money line (red, strike $180) also falls, from about -0.08 at 25% IV to -0.17 at 50% IV. This is vomma: away from the money, vega itself grows as IV rises, so a static read of vega (a single number held flat) understates the wings' IV sensitivity. For a credit seller this is the warning that a far wing becomes more IV-sensitive than its static vega suggests, especially into a volatility event.

The chart above shows vega from the short option's perspective, plotted against delta, the trader's usual strike gauge. It assumes a stock price of 200, a strike of 200, and a fixed implied volatility (IV) of 25% as the baseline; the lines show 14, 45 and 90 days to expiry. Because the panels show short options, every value is negative: vega is most negative near the 0.5 delta point, about -0.14 per 1% IV at 14 days, -0.24 at 45 days, and -0.33 at 90 days, and rises toward zero as delta moves toward 0 or 1. For an iron-condor seller this is where the short vega sits: the 15-to-20 delta wings sit near zero on the curve, carrying less (negative) vega than the at-the-money options they sell.
2. Iron Butterfly
- Long iron butterfly: sell an ATM put and an ATM call, buy an OTM put and an OTM call. Maximum theta in a narrow range; profits when the stock stays tight.
- Short iron butterfly: the opposite; profits on a big breakout.
| Long iron butterfly | Short iron butterfly | |
|---|---|---|
| Net | Credit | Debit |
| Best when | High IV, tight range | Breakout expected |
| Risk | Defined | Defined |


The charts above show the long and short iron butterfly's profit and loss against the underlying price at expiry. They assume a stock price of $200, 45 days to expiry, and a fixed implied volatility (IV) of 25% as the baseline; both use the $190 / $200 / $210 strikes. The long iron butterfly sells the $200 put (about $5.5) and the $200 call (about $6.2), and buys the $190 put (about $1.9) and the $210 call (about $2.5), collecting a net credit of about $7.4; the short iron butterfly is the exact opposite, paying a net debit of about $7.4. At expiry the long version peaks at the middle strike, about +$7.4 at $200, +$5.4 at $198 or $202, +$2.4 at $195 or $205, and is capped at about -$2.6 beyond $190 or $210; the breakevens sit at about $192.6 and $207.4. The short version mirrors it, losing about -$7.4 at $200 and paying about +$2.6 outside the wings.
The dashed lines show the same positions 10 days in (35 days to expiry). Both curves flatten dramatically: the long iron butterfly is only about +$0.3 at $200, and the breakevens tighten to about $193.5 and $206.4; the short version is about -$0.3 at $200. The long version's maximum is only realized at expiry if the stock pins at $200, so it must be held into expiration or carefully manage the risks.


The charts above show how the 10-days-in P&L changes if implied volatility moves 10 points from the 25% baseline. The gray line is the baseline, the red dashed line is with IV 10 points higher (35%), and the blue dashed line is with IV 10 points lower (15%). A long iron butterfly is net short vega (the two sold ATM strikes carry more vega than the wings), so higher IV pushes the curve down, about -$0.5 at $200 instead of +$0.3, while lower IV lifts it to about +$1.9. The short version mirrors this: higher IV helps it, about +$0.5 at $200, while lower IV hurts it, about -$1.9. This is why the long (credit) iron butterfly prefers high IV that is falling, and the short version is a breakout-volatility trade.
3. Long Iron Condor
Buy an inner OTM spread and sell an outer OTM spread on both sides: long the near put ($190) and near call ($210), short the far put ($180) and far call ($220). With the chart's strikes (buy the $190 put and $210 call, sell the $180 put and $220 call at 25% IV) this costs a net debit of about $3.2, because the bought inner legs are worth more than the sold outer wings.
- Max loss: about -$3.2 if the stock stays in the inner range (190–210).
- Profit: about +$6.8 if the stock breaks out beyond the outer wings (at or below 180, at or above 220).
- Best use: a low-IV environment where you expect a breakout or volatility to expand.

The chart above shows the long iron condor's profit and loss against the underlying price at expiry. It assumes a stock price of $200, 45 days to expiry, and a fixed implied volatility (IV) of 25% as the baseline; the position buys the $190 put (about $1.9) and the $210 call (about $2.5), and sells the $180 put (about $0.4) and the $220 call (about $0.8), paying a net debit of about $3.2. At expiry the payoff is a wide valley: about -$3.2 for any stock price between $190 and $210, then it climbs, about +$1.8 at $185 or $215, and about +$6.8 at $180 or $220, capped there by the outer wings' width. The breakevens sit at about $186.8 and $213.2.
The dashed line shows the same position 10 days in (35 days to expiry). The valley flattens: at $200 the loss is only about -$0.6, and the breakevens tighten to about $192.8 and $206.1. The wings also pay less because the sold outer legs still carry time value, so the full $6.8 is only realized at expiry if the stock breaks out beyond them.

The chart above shows how the 10-days-in P&L changes if implied volatility moves 10 points from the 25% baseline. The gray line is the baseline, the red dashed line is with IV 10 points higher (35%), and the blue dashed line is with IV 10 points lower (15%). The long iron condor is net long vega (the bought inner legs carry more vega than the sold outer wings), so higher IV lifts the curve: at $200 the position is about +$1.0 instead of -$0.6. Lower IV pushes it down to about -$2.4 at $200. This is a low-IV, breakout trade: you want IV to rise as the stock makes its move, not fall.
4. Broken-Wing Condor
A short iron condor where one wing is wider than the other. The wider wing is usually on the put side to eliminate the downside loss tail.
- Credit: collected premium (often higher than a balanced condor).
- Risk: one-sided; the narrow (call) side keeps a defined loss.
- Best use: you are comfortable with a one-sided risk profile and want extra premium.

The chart above shows the broken-wing condor's profit and loss against the underlying price at expiry. It assumes a stock price of $200, 45 days to expiry, and a fixed implied volatility (IV) of 25% as the baseline; the position buys the $180 put (about $0.4) and the $225 call (about $0.4), and sells the $190 put (about $1.9) and the $210 call (about $2.5), collecting a net credit of about $3.6. At expiry the payoff is a plateau of about +$3.6 between $190 and $210, then it steps down to about -$1.4 at $185 or $215, about -$6.4 at $180 or $220, and the wider upper wing extends the loss to about -$11.4 from $225 up. The breakevens sit at about $186.4 and $213.6, and the one-sided risk shows up beyond the wider wing.
The dashed line shows the same position 10 days in (35 days to expiry). The plateau narrows and the middle dips: at $200 the position is about +$0.7, and the breakevens tighten to about $191.1 and $205.1. The full credit is only kept at expiry if the stock stays between $190 and $210.

The chart above shows how the 10-days-in P&L changes if implied volatility moves 10 points from the 25% baseline. The gray line is the baseline, the red dashed line is with IV 10 points higher (35%), and the blue dashed line is with IV 10 points lower (15%). The broken-wing condor is net short vega, so higher IV pushes the curve down: at $200 the position is about -$1.2 instead of +$0.7. Lower IV lifts it to about +$2.8 at $200. As with the balanced condor, this is a high-IV range trade; the wider wing trades a lower cost for a one-sided loss zone.
5. Jade Lizard
Sell an OTM put, sell an OTM call, and buy a higher OTM call. The call credit spread caps the upside.
- Profit: full credit if the stock stays between the short put and the short call.
- Risk: the naked put tail if the stock falls hard.
- Best use: a mildly bullish-to-neutral income trade when IV is high.

The chart above shows the jade lizard's profit and loss against the underlying price at expiry. It assumes a stock price of $200, 45 days to expiry, and a fixed implied volatility (IV) of 25% as the baseline; the position sells the $190 put (about $1.9) and the $210 call (about $2.5), and buys the $220 call (about $0.8) to cap the upside, collecting a net credit of about $3.6. At expiry the payoff is a plateau of about +$3.6 between $190 and $210, then it steps down to about -$1.4 at $185 or $215 and about -$6.4 at $180 or $220, while the downside is left naked: the loss grows without a cap, about -$36.4 at $150. The breakevens sit at about $186.4 and $213.6, and the real risk is the put tail below the short put.
The dashed line shows the same position 10 days in (35 days to expiry). The plateau narrows: at $200 the position is about +$0.7, and the breakevens tighten to about $194.2 and $208.2. The full credit is only kept at expiry if the stock stays between $190 and $210, and the naked put tail remains the danger on a sharp drop.

The chart above shows how the 10-days-in P&L changes if implied volatility moves 10 points from the 25% baseline. The gray line is the baseline, the red dashed line is with IV 10 points higher (35%), and the blue dashed line is with IV 10 points lower (15%). The jade lizard is net short vega, so higher IV pushes the curve down: at $200 the position is about -$1.6 instead of +$0.7. Lower IV lifts it to about +$2.9 at $200. As a credit trade it wants high IV that falls; a rising-IV shock hurts the whole curve and makes the naked put tail worse.

7. Risk Management
- Credit spreads: assignment risk on the short legs; confirm your broker’s assignment and liquidation rules and manage around earnings.
- Long iron condor: theta works against you until the breakout; enter near low IV and a catalyst.
- Broken wing / jade lizard: the naked or one-sided tails need defined risk management; size small.
